  2. This site includes case information for Civil, Small Claims, Family Law, and Probate. Limited jurisdiction cases are cases in which the dollar amount or value of property in dispute does not exceed $25,000.00. This includes Small Claims and most Unlawful Detainers. General jurisdiction cases include all other matters.

  7. Oct 15, 2024 · The Advanced Attorney Portal went live on Monday and some attorneys have found it saves times. A $100 per year subscription service that allows attorneys to better view and track their cases and remote hearings went live on the Los Angeles County Superior Court's website this week, and some lawyers who have used it noticed time saving and administrative benefits.
